What happened

Valuation+13.9%high confidence

CrowdStrike surged +15.14% to $238.05 as cybersecurity stocks rallied on AI safety warnings from frontier lab leaders (Anthropic, OpenAI) over the weekend. Per 247wallst.com and investing.com, investors rotated from semiconductor stocks into pure-play security providers, with CEO George Kurtz publicly emphasizing that AI-driven cyber threats operate at machine speed, requiring urgent real-time defense. Volume reached 12.8M shares (4.36x the time-adjusted average), and the stock hit new all-time highs.
